COMPANY OVERVIEW
Imagined and created by Cason and Virginia Callaway more than seven decades ago, Callaway Resort & Gardens (CRG) is a refuge from everyday stresses for millions of visitors. The ever-changing 2,500-acre historic woodlands garden with miles of nature trails is designed to celebrate the area's natural beauty and native species, encouraging families to get outdoors, naturally connecting with each other and with nature. Located just over an hour from Atlanta, the resort is tucked away in picturesque Pine Mountain, Georgia.
Activities and recreation include biking, hiking, golfing, birdwatching, swimming, ziplining, canoeing, fishing, or simply unwinding at the spa. With a tropical butterfly conservatory, a lakeside white sand beach, and special events, every season offers different things to experience.
Resort accommodations include 300 guest rooms at a full-service lodge or family-friendly cottages and villas with living rooms, full-size kitchens, screened patios, fireplaces, and barbecues all included. Resort amenities include a world-class spa, thirty-six holes of golf, and a variety of restaurants.
ROLE OVERVIEW
The Programming Manager is a passionate and detail-oriented professional who is happiest creating top-notch guest experiences for Callaway Resort & Gardens (CRG) visitors, whether they are here for the day or staying with us overnight. This manager creates and oversees a calendar of activities, assuring there is always something happening at CRG and creating memorable experiences! This critical position ensures activities are scheduled efficiently, communicated effectively, and executed at excellence so guests' expectations are consistently exceeded.
